ammine: Meaning and Definition of

am•mine

Pronunciation: (am'ēn, u-mēn'), [key]
— n. Chem.
  1. a compound containing one or more ammonia molecules in coordinate linkage.
  2. any coordination compound containing one or more ammonia molecules bonded to a metal ion.
